Crimes Against Elderly: Son Unremorseful Over Killing Mother (NSW. Australia)

I wish I'd murdered mother earlier: killer
December 5, 2008

A man who stabbed his fiesty environmentalist mother to death says his only regret is that he didn't murder her 20 years ago, a Sydney court has been told.

Adam Patrick Owens, 33, of Cremorne on Sydney's north shore, has admitted murdering his mother Doris Owens, 69, between September 6 and 9, 2006.

The body of the woman, known as a staunch environmental campaigner in the seaside village of Swanhaven, near Sussex Inlet on the NSW south coast, was not found until September 12, 2006.
Owens pleaded guilty to her murder moments before he was due to face trial last month.

Justice Lucy McCallum will hand down a sentence on December 19.
